FAILURE AND STRANGE DUMP SUMMARY:
 jafar2     /home/host lev 0 FAILED [out of tape]

It says "out of tape", but a tape error is more likely.

...
Tape Size (GB)...........  4.71
Tape Used (%)............  9.65
Filesystems Taped........     6

Am I correct that your tapesize is configured to be about 45 Gbyte. (What kind of tape is that, I've never seen a tape with such a capacity.)

...
 taper: tape ARCH_DE2_003 kb 6878912 fm 7 writing
file: I/O error

While writing the 7th backup image to tape, there was an IO error around 6878912 Kbyte or about 6.6 Gbyte. That seems to be far from the expected capacity of 45 Gbyte, so it's probably a tape error. Try a cleaning tape. Look for scsi errors in /var/adm/messages.
